Vikisöz:Araçlar/Bekleyen değişiklikler kutusu
Bekleyen değişiklikler kutusu, Sürüm Kontrolü uygulaması kapsamında editör onayı bekleyen sayfaları sol kenarda oluşturulan bir kutu içerisinde görüntüleyen ve editörlerin incelemelerini gerçekleştirebilecekleri bağlantıları veren bir JavaScript betiğidir.
Amaç
[değiştir]Bu betiğin amacı, editörlerin bekleyen değişikliklere daha rahat erişmesini sağlayarak hızlı çalışmalarına olanak sağlamaktır.
Kullanım
[değiştir]Kurulum
[değiştir]Bu betiği kullanmak için Tercihlerim menüsünde yer alan Küçük Araçlar sekmesinden "Bekleyen değişiklikler kutusu" seçeneğini seçebilir ya da alternatif olarak aşağıdaki kodu common.js sayfanıza yerleştirebilirsiniz:
// Bekleyen değişiklikler kutusu - [[VP:BDK]]
importScript('MediaWiki:Gadget-BekleyenDeğişiklikler.js');
Betik, aşağıdaki görünümlerde sorunsuz olarak çalışmaktadır:
- Vector (Varsayılan görünüm)
- Monobook
- Chick
- MySkin
- Simple
Şu görünümlerde ise çalışmamaktadır:
- Classic
- Cologne Blue
- Modern
- Nostalgia
Özelleştirme
[değiştir]
parametre = değer;
(sonda noktalı virgül olduğundan emin olun)
Parametreler
[değiştir]- pendch_enabled - menünün açık ve etkinleştirilmiş olarak başlaması
- olası değerler: true veya false. varsayılan: false
- pendch_refresh - saniye cinsinden listenin güncellenme sıklığı.
- olası değerler: 2 ve üzeri sayılar. varsayılan: 10.
- pendch_num_pages - menüde listelenecek sayfa sayısı
- olası değerler: 1 ila 50 arası sayılar. varsayılan: 10.
- pendch_num_idle_req - kendi kendine kapatmadan önce güncellenme sayısı.
- olası değerler: 5 ila 1000 arası sayılar. varsayılan: 50
- pendch_diffonly - tam sayfayı aşağıda göstermeden yalnızca farkı göster.
- olası değerler: 1 (yalnızca farkı göster), 0 (sayfanın tamamını göster). varsayılan: 1
- Not: diffonly açıldığında sayfanın üst bölümünde ihtiyaç duyulması halinde sayfa içeriğinin tamamını görmenizi mümkün kılan bir bağlantı yer almaktadır.
Örnekler
[değiştir]Menüyü varsayılan olarak açık tutma, her 30 saniyede bir güncellenme, aynı anda maksimum 5 sayfa listeleme ve 20 güncellemeden sonra kapanma ayarları:
pendch_enabled = true;
pendch_refresh = 30;
pendch_num_pages = 5;
pendch_num_idle_req = 20;
Kaynak
[değiştir]Kaynak bilgileri için betik sayfasına bakınız.